The garage occupancy feed for the Brindlewood campus arrives over a message queue every thirty seconds, one record per level, published by the Stallgrid edge boxes. Counts can briefly go negative when a sensor double-fires on exit; the ingest job clamps these to zero and flags the interval. If the feed stalls for more than five minutes, the dashboard falls back to the last known snapshot. Sensor mappings, queue names, and the replay procedure are documented on the internal page below.

runbook for tahog-kadug: https://gitlab.qirvanworks.corp/projects/pages/view/b139298aed28

## Ownership

This directory tracks the Pellwright query planner regression introduced in release 14.2, where nested join hints are reordered incorrectly under the cost model. New contractors should read `REPRO.md` first and avoid touching the cardinality estimator until the fix branch lands. Benchmark results must be attached to any proposed patch. Coordination, triage decisions, and merge approval for this workstream all run through the engineer listed below.

named custodian: Brivan Eliath Quenox Frador

When localizing date formats in a Lanternbox plugin, never hand-format dates yourself. Always call `lb.formatDate()` with the host locale object, which respects the viewer's region settings, calendar system, and first-day-of-week preference. Hardcoded patterns like `MM/DD/YYYY` will fail certification review. Sample locale fixtures for testing are bundled in the SDK under `fixtures/locales`. If a locale you need is missing, request it from the platform team at the address below.

escalation mailbox, yajeg-bageg: quenax.olidor@lumiccorp.internal